Local Laws Overview
In Villahermosa, some key aspects of local laws relevant to MTT include:
- Federal Telecommunications and Broadcasting Law: Governs telecom and broadcasting sectors, focusing on competition, consumer rights, and service quality.
- General Law on Protection of Personal Data: Outlines the responsibilities of entities handling personal data, with emphasis on consent and data security.
- Copyrights Law: Provides protection to authors and creators of media, ensuring that their works are used following the right permissions.
- E-commerce Legislation: Governs online commercial activities, including digital contracts and consumer protection in online transactions.
Frequently Asked Questions
What types of media fall under the regulation in Villahermosa?
Regulations cover a broad spectrum, including traditional broadcast media such as television and radio, digital platforms, and internet services.
How are telecommunications services regulated in Villahermosa?
They're regulated under federal and local laws ensuring fair competition, consumer protection, and quality service delivery to users.
What is the role of the Federal Telecommunications Institute (IFT)?
IFT is the primary regulatory body overseeing telecommunications and broadcasting, ensuring compliance with regulations and fostering market competitiveness.
How can I protect my intellectual property in media or technology?
Through registering copyrights, trademarks, and patents, and by drafting enforceable contracts that specify IP rights and usage.
What are my privacy rights regarding online data in Villahermosa?
Your data is protected under the General Law on Protection of Personal Data, which requires clear consent and defines measures for data security.
How does e-commerce legislation affect businesses in Villahermosa?
It ensures consumer rights in online transactions, dictates the validity of digital contracts, and requires businesses to adhere to specific disclosure standards.
Can foreign companies operate within the MTT sector in Villahermosa?
Yes, but they must comply with local laws, including foreign investment regulations and sector-specific licensing requirements.

Additional Resources
For someone in need of legal advice in the MTT field, consider these resources:
- Federal Telecommunications Institute (IFT): The regulatory body for telecommunications and broadcasting.
- Mexican Institute of Industrial Property (IMPI): Facilitates the registration of intellectual property rights.
- Local Chambers of Commerce: Often provide resources and networking opportunities for businesses in the MTT sector.
- Consumer Protection Federal Agency (PROFECO): Provides support and information regarding consumer rights in telecommunications.
